Connect with us

Corporate Video

video
AI

AI-Augmented Development: How Generative AI is Accelerating App Creation in 2025

AI-Augmented Development: How Generative AI is Accelerating App Creation in 2025

App development has come a long way. What once required months of coding and debugging is now faster, more efficient, and less prone to errors. Early software development was all about manual effort, where every feature had to be written from scratch. Then came frameworks, reusable components, and low-code platforms, making things easier. But in 2025, the biggest change isn’t just about writing code faster—it’s about AI stepping in to assist at every stage of development.

AI-augmented development is reshaping how apps are built. Generative AI can suggest code, fix bugs, automate testing, and even generate UI designs based on simple descriptions. It’s not replacing developers, but it’s making their work smarter and cutting down the time it takes to build high-quality apps. Companies that integrate AI into their development process are already seeing better efficiency, reduced costs, and faster project completion. This shift isn’t just about keeping up with trends—it’s about staying ahead in a world where speed and quality matter more than ever.

The Advent of Generative AI in App Development

Generative AI is changing how apps are built. At its core, it’s a type of artificial intelligence that creates content—whether that’s text, images, code, or even entire applications—based on patterns it has learned from large datasets. In software development, this means AI can write code, suggest improvements, detect errors, and automate repetitive tasks, allowing developers to focus on bigger decisions.

AI is now part of almost every stage of app development. From generating UI components and writing boilerplate code to automating testing and debugging, AI speeds up the process while reducing the chances of human error. Developers no longer have to write every line from scratch or spend hours fixing minor issues—AI-powered tools can handle these tasks in seconds.

Recent advancements have made AI tools even more useful for developers. GitHub Copilot, for example, acts as an AI coding assistant, suggesting lines of code as you type. ChatGPT can help debug issues or generate complex logic based on simple instructions. AutoML tools allow developers to build machine learning models without needing deep expertise. These tools aren’t just making development faster—they’re changing how teams approach problem-solving.

As generative AI continues to improve, it’s becoming an essential part of modern app development. It’s not about replacing developers, but about giving them better tools to work smarter, reduce manual effort, and bring ideas to life faster.

Transforming the Development Lifecycle

Generative AI is changing the way apps are built, not just in coding but at every stage of the development process. From idea generation to testing, AI is making each step faster and more efficient.

Idea Generation and Planning

Coming up with app ideas and deciding on the right features can take time. AI speeds up this process by analyzing trends, user preferences, and existing products to suggest new ideas. Instead of relying solely on brainstorming sessions, businesses can use AI to predict what users might need based on market data.

AI-driven market analysis tools scan customer reviews, competitor apps, and search trends to identify gaps in the market. This helps businesses make informed decisions about what features to include. AI-powered chatbots can also interact with stakeholders to refine app concepts based on specific requirements.

Design and Prototyping

Once the idea is set, designing the app is the next step. AI plays a big role in this by generating UI layouts, color schemes, and even full-app prototypes based on simple text inputs. Developers and designers can describe what they need, and AI-powered design tools generate multiple versions instantly.

Tools like Uizard and Figma’s AI-powered features help create wireframes and design elements quickly. This makes it easier for teams to experiment with different layouts and get a working prototype without spending weeks on manual design work.

Coding and Development

AI-powered coding tools have made writing code faster and more accurate. Platforms like GitHub Copilot, CodeWhisperer, and Tabnine suggest entire functions, complete repetitive tasks, and even fix syntax errors in real time.

By reducing manual coding efforts, AI helps developers focus on logic and structure instead of spending time on boilerplate code. It also cuts down on errors by detecting issues as the code is written, making debugging easier. The result is a faster development cycle with fewer roadblocks.

Testing and Quality Assurance

Testing is often one of the most time-consuming parts of development, but AI is making it easier to find and fix issues before they cause problems. AI-powered testing tools can automatically run test cases, analyze performance, and detect bugs without human intervention.

AI can simulate real user behavior, checking how an app responds under different conditions. It can also predict potential security vulnerabilities before launch. By automating testing, businesses save time and reduce the chances of post-launch issues affecting users.

From start to finish, AI is making app development more efficient. It’s helping teams move faster without sacrificing quality, making it an essential part of modern development workflows.

Benefits of AI-Augmented Development

AI is making app development faster, more cost-effective, and more creative. It’s helping developers complete projects with fewer resources while improving overall quality.

Enhanced Productivity

AI is reducing the time developers spend on repetitive work. A study by GitHub found that developers using AI coding assistants complete tasks up to 55% faster than those who don’t. Instead of manually writing boilerplate code or debugging for hours, AI-powered tools suggest solutions in real time, allowing teams to focus on more complex problems.

Companies adopting AI-assisted development have also reported fewer errors and smoother workflows. With AI handling parts of coding, testing, and debugging, developers can shift their focus to strategy and user experience.

Cost Efficiency

AI is cutting down development costs by automating tasks that once required extra manpower. Generating UI components, running automated tests, and writing repetitive code are now handled by AI, reducing the need for large development teams.

By catching errors early and improving workflow speed, AI also lowers post-launch maintenance costs. Fewer bugs mean fewer patches, which translates to long-term savings for businesses.

Improved Creativity and Innovation

AI is giving developers more room to experiment with design and functionality. Instead of being limited by coding constraints, developers can describe ideas in simple terms, and AI tools generate working prototypes or code snippets. This allows for faster iteration and testing of new concepts.

AI-assisted design tools also help create user-friendly interfaces without requiring extensive design skills. Developers can test multiple UI layouts quickly, making it easier to build apps that look and feel better for users.

With AI taking care of routine tasks, developers can focus on bigger ideas, leading to more creative and high-quality apps.

Challenges and Considerations

AI is making app development faster and smarter, but it comes with its own set of challenges. Developers and businesses need to be aware of these issues to use AI effectively without running into problems later.

Data Privacy and Security

AI tools often rely on large amounts of data to function properly. This raises concerns about how sensitive information is handled. If an AI system is trained on user data, there’s always a risk of exposure or misuse. Companies need to make sure they follow strict data privacy rules, especially when handling personal or financial information.

There have been cases where AI-generated code included security flaws or reused existing code with vulnerabilities. This makes security audits and manual checks just as important as ever. Developers should treat AI-generated output the same way they would human-written code—by reviewing, testing, and securing it properly.

Dependence on AI

Relying too much on AI can create new risks. While AI can generate code and suggest fixes, it doesn’t always understand the bigger picture of a project. Developers who blindly accept AI-generated suggestions without reviewing them might introduce errors or inefficiencies.

There’s also the risk of losing critical thinking and problem-solving skills if teams become too dependent on AI. Developers still need to understand how and why certain code works instead of letting AI make all the decisions. AI should be a tool, not a replacement for human expertise.

Skill Requirements

AI-assisted development isn’t just about using new tools—it requires a different way of thinking. Developers need to understand how AI works, how to guide it, and how to verify its output. This means learning about AI models, prompt engineering, and AI ethics alongside traditional programming skills.

Businesses hiring developers will start looking for those who can work alongside AI, not just those who can code. Developers who adapt to AI-assisted workflows will have a big advantage in the coming years, while those who resist the shift may find themselves struggling to keep up.

AI is here to stay, but making the most of it requires a balance between automation and human oversight. Developers and businesses that approach AI with the right mindset will get the most out of it without falling into common pitfalls.

The Role of AI Development Services and Companies

Not every business has the in-house skills to build AI-powered applications, and that’s where AI development companies come in. They help businesses integrate AI into their projects without the need for deep technical expertise. Whether it’s automating processes, improving user experience, or making data-driven decisions, working with an experienced AI team can make a big difference.

Partnering with AI Development Companies

AI is a specialized field, and not all development teams are equipped to handle it. AI development companies focus solely on building AI-driven solutions, which means they stay updated on the latest advancements, tools, and best practices. Instead of spending months hiring and training an internal team, businesses can get started right away by working with an AI development firm.

These companies also help businesses avoid common mistakes, such as using AI in the wrong areas or failing to consider ethical concerns. With their experience, they can guide businesses in using AI where it actually makes sense, ensuring projects are practical and deliver real value.

Access to Expertise

AI development isn’t just about writing code—it involves working with machine learning models, training data, and optimization techniques. AI development firms bring in specialists who understand how to build and fine-tune these systems.

These experts also have access to cutting-edge tools and infrastructure that might be too expensive or complex for a single business to set up on its own. Whether it’s AI-powered automation, chatbots, predictive analytics, or computer vision, a dedicated AI development team can help businesses make the most of what AI has to offer.

Customized Solutions

Every business has different needs, and AI isn’t a one-size-fits-all solution. AI development companies work closely with businesses to understand their specific challenges and create solutions that fit their requirements.

For example, an e-commerce platform might need AI for personalized product recommendations, while a fintech company might need fraud detection powered by AI. Instead of using generic AI tools, businesses can get a system that fits their industry and goals.

Working with AI development services helps businesses avoid guesswork and wasted resources. With the right team, companies can integrate AI in a way that actually improves their products and operations without unnecessary complexity.

Hiring AI Developers: What to Look For

Bringing AI into app development requires the right talent. Hiring AI developers isn’t just about finding someone who knows how to code—it’s about finding professionals who understand AI’s complexities and can work well with a team. Here’s what to look for when hiring AI developers.

Essential Skills and Expertise

AI development involves more than writing software. The right candidate should have a strong background in:

  • Machine learning frameworks – TensorFlow, PyTorch, and Scikit-learn are widely used for building AI models.
  • Programming languages – Python is the most common, but knowledge of R, Java, or C++ can be useful depending on the project.
  • Data handling and processing – AI relies on clean, well-structured data, so experience with SQL, Pandas, and NumPy is important.
  • Model training and deployment – Developers should know how to train, optimize, and deploy AI models using cloud services like AWS, Google Cloud, or Azure.
  • AI ethics and security – Understanding bias in AI models, data privacy, and security risks is becoming more important as AI adoption grows.

Evaluating Experience

AI development isn’t just about theoretical knowledge—it requires hands-on experience. When hiring AI developers, businesses should look at:

  • Past projects – A strong portfolio of AI-driven applications shows real-world problem-solving skills.
  • Industry-specific experience – AI solutions for healthcare, finance, and e-commerce all have different requirements. A candidate with relevant experience will adapt faster.
  • Open-source contributions – Developers who contribute to AI libraries or research projects often have deeper expertise and stay updated with industry changes.

Technical tests or sample projects can also help assess whether a candidate can apply AI to real-world scenarios.

Cultural Fit and Collaboration

AI developers don’t work in isolation. They need to collaborate with software engineers, data scientists, product managers, and designers. A good hire is someone who:

  • Communicates complex ideas clearly – AI concepts can be difficult to explain, so developers who can break them down for non-technical teams are valuable.
  • Works well in a team – AI models are only one part of an application. Developers should be comfortable working with others to integrate AI into the full development process.
  • Is adaptable and open to learning – AI is developing rapidly. The best developers stay curious and are willing to update their skills as new tools and techniques emerge.

Finding the right AI developer isn’t just about technical skills—it’s about hiring someone who can build practical solutions, collaborate effectively, and grow with the company.

AI's Evolving Role in App Development

AI in app development isn’t a one-time shift—it’s an ongoing process. As AI models improve and new tools emerge, developers and businesses will need to keep up to stay ahead.

Continuous Learning and Adaptation

AI is moving fast. What works today might be outdated in a year. Developers who work with AI need to keep learning—whether it’s new machine learning models, better automation tools, or smarter ways to process data. Businesses that invest in training their teams or working with AI experts will be in a better position to make the most of these advancements.

Online courses, AI research papers, and hands-on experimentation are becoming essential for anyone working in this space. Companies looking to hire AI developers should look for professionals who stay curious and keep upgrading their skills.

Emerging Trends

AI isn’t just improving app development—it’s also merging with other technologies. Some of the biggest trends shaping 2025 include:

  • AI + AR/VR – AI-generated content is making AR and VR experiences more interactive, from virtual shopping assistants to AI-driven game characters.
  • No-code AI development – More platforms are offering AI-powered app builders that let non-developers create software with simple prompts.
  • AI-driven automation – From writing and debugging code to testing and deployment, AI is making software development faster and less resource-intensive.
  • Ethical AI and transparency – As AI takes on a bigger role, businesses are focusing more on responsible AI usage, making sure models are fair, unbiased, and explainable.

Conclusion

Generative AI is changing the way apps are built. It’s helping developers work faster, cut costs, and create better user experiences. But AI isn’t doing this alone—it still needs skilled developers and smart decision-making to be used effectively.

For businesses, adopting AI in development isn’t just about using the latest tech—it’s about staying competitive. Working with experienced AI development teams and hiring the right developers can make all the difference. Those who take AI seriously now will be the ones leading the way in the years ahead.

Post Author

Vivek Adatia

Vivek Adatia

Vivek is a seasoned writer and technology aficionado at WebCluses Infotech, who has a knack for crafting captivating content. He strives to keep readers informed about the latest trends and advancements in the ever-evolving world of software development & technology. His concise yet insightful articles offer valuable insights, helping businesses looking for a digital transformation.

imgimg

Hire AI developers from WebClues Infotech to integrate generative AI into your app development process.

WebClues Infotech specializes in AI development services, tapping into advanced generative AI tools to refine workflows, optimize software quality, and reduce costs.

Get a Quote!

Our Recent Blogs

Sharing knowledge helps us grow, stay motivated and stay on-track with frontier technological and design concepts. Developers and business innovators, customers and employees - our events are all about you.

Contact Information

Let’s Transform Your Idea into Reality - Get in Touch

India

India

Ahmedabad

1007-1010, Signature-1,
S.G.Highway, Makarba,
Ahmedabad, Gujarat - 380051

Rajkot

1308 - The Spire, 150 Feet Ring Rd,
Manharpura 1, Madhapar, Rajkot, Gujarat - 360007

UAE

UAE

Dubai

Dubai Silicon Oasis, DDP,
Building A1, Dubai, UAE

USA

USA

Delaware

8 The Green, Dover DE, 19901, USA

New Jersey

513 Baldwin Ave, Jersey City,
NJ 07306, USA

California

4701 Patrick Henry Dr. Building
26 Santa Clara, California 95054

Australia

Australia

Queensland

120 Highgate Street, Coopers Plains, Brisbane, Queensland 4108

UK

UK

London

85 Great Portland Street, First
Floor, London, W1W 7LT

Canada

Canada

Burlington

5096 South Service Rd,
ON Burlington, L7l 4X4